+1 - Admiral were the cheapest for the M3 (by a good hundred quid) and were the only firm that were not insisting on a tracker being fitted (saving me a further £300-£400) - they then went on to quote for the missus car, and knocked another £90 of her insurance if we took out the multicar deal.

The phone operators were great, very helpful and in the UK!!! - All paperwork arrived within a couple of days and was all present and correct

Not had to claim so cannot comment on that side of things but have all the extras in place (included, not extra cost) such as legal cover, courtesy car, windscreen cover, etc..
